In the 1300s, John Wycliffe believed that common people should have access to the Bible in readable English. His own translation got the ball rolling, and has inspired others to continue that outreach all around the world. Since 1942, Wycliffe Bible Translators and its partner organizations have been involved in the translation of New Testaments or Bibles in more than 1,400 languages. The ministry also provides literacy training, and helps new believers apply the truths of Scripture to their daily lives. Wycliffe was featured in #872: “The Morning Star”.
